Hand knotted "Almati" Rug 200, Florian Pretet and Lisa Mukhia Pretet Made to Order Dimensions can be ordered, please contact us Dimensions: 200 x 290 cm Materials: 65% wool, 35% silk 125 knots/sq in Variations of color available. Mille points, echoes the body markings embellishing African tribe Mbuti over centuries. Symbols of beauty, celebrating ones passage through life, the elevated contrasting silk dots seem immobile yet imply movement. Ones perspective shifts given space and motion. Atelier Février designs and creates luxury, timeless, statement rugs. They don’t aim to follow any trend but to be the reflection of a genuine everyday life’s inspiration. The signature patterns are richly detailed, highlighted by a one-of-kind color palette and original cut-outs. The designs are the result of a thorough manual process for a natural finish. First being hand-drawn on paper, then scaled-up and hand knotted by expert weavers, the steps involves the combined workforce of around 50 people. Each rug is therefore unique due to its handmade nature. The rugs are made of premium wool from Tibet - known to have a high content of lanolin that protects the rug over time and ages beautifully - and the finest silk from China for added lustre and durability, ensuring the rugs being suitable for personal and public spaces. The average turnaround is minimum of 14 weeks.Fair trade standards and eco-friendly work methods are at the core of Atelier Fe´vrier’s approach. Atelier Février is committed to using 100% natural fibers and dyes, creating ethical work opportunities for those in Nepal and Tibet and promoting traditional Asian craftsmanship. Founders of Atelier Fe´vrier, Florian Pretet and Lisa Mukhia Pretet design together outstanding rugs skillfully hand knotted in Nepal. Their pieces are the epitome of contemporary art fused with traditional craftsmanship. A graduate form the Parisian Fashion School Studio Berc¸ot. Florian Pretet is a French designer who worked several years for a prestigious French fashion brand that led him to Kathmandu. Through Atelier Fe´vrier he breathes life into his drawing, translating them into beautiful design pieces. Born and raised between Darjeeling and Kathmandu - where traditions are the culture’s cornerstone - Lisa Mukhia Pretet is a keen entrepreneur with a strong love for fashion and Craft. She lived in Nepal for 15 years where her work experience and her exposure to vernacular techniques, brought forward her fascination for traditional crafts that have been passed along for generations. Real life partners, coming from different cultural and professional background, their association is drawn from those common passions for art, fashion, Craft and expertise.
